When a specimen of material is loaded in such a way that it extends it is said to be in tension. On the other hand, if the material compresses and shortens it is said to be in compression. On an atomic level, the molecules or atoms are forced apart when in tension whereas in compression they are forced together. WebApr 16, 2024 · The compressive strength of cube was found to be 27.77 N/mm 2 in controlled mix and of 29.55 N/mm 2 at 55% fine aggregate replacement by copper slag at 7 day’s curing age. The compressive strength of concrete cube at 28 day’s was found to be 37.77 N/mm 2 in controlled specimen and of 42.88 N/mm 2 at 55% fine
